Are you having troubles with CFEclipse?

Then let someone know. I've seen a few blogs over the last year or two like Michael Sharman's that detail issues with CFEclipse, explaining why it just doesn't work for them and generally ends with something like "back to [insert homesite or dreamweaver here] for me".

I know that when I see a blog entry like this before even posting a comment the first thing I do is check out the mailing list to see if they have left a thread there explaining their issues. Most of the time I don't find a post and there lies the rub. Needless to say though that without finding out why they have a bug or how to fix it they just post a blog entry on how CFE just "doesn't work". This isn't the first time this has happened and probably won't be the last.
